⚠️ Ecosystem lock-in warning: Bambu and Prusa are not interchangeable ecosystems. Bambu's AMS system is proprietary — multicolor filaments, cloud features, and software are tightly coupled. Prusa's MMU3 is open source. Switching ecosystems later means replacing filament profiles, software presets, and accessories. Choose based on your long-term workflow, not just the current specs.

Materials

Bambu Lab X2D only
ABSHeat and impact resistant — needs enclosure
PANylon — strong and wear-resistant, needs dry storage
PA-CFCarbon-fibre nylon — very stiff, abrasive to standard nozzles
PCPolycarbonate — extremely tough, challenging to print
PETG-CFCarbon-fibre PETG — stiffer than PETG, easy to print
Both
PLAEasy to print, no enclosure needed — everyday parts
PETGTougher, slightly flexible, moisture-resistant
ASAUV-stable ABS alternative — outdoor parts, needs enclosure
TPUFlexible rubber-like — phone cases, gaskets, wheels

Why buy each?

Bambu Lab X2D

Dual-nozzle in the X1C footprint

A second Bowden-fed nozzle enables two-material prints and soluble supports without a purge tower, in the same compact 256 mm class as the X1C it replaces.

65°C active heated chamber

Unlike the X1C's passive chamber warming, the X2D actively heats to 65°C — enough for the bulk of engineering filaments including ABS, ASA, and nylon.

Three-stage HEPA and toolhead camera

Improved filtration and a toolhead-mounted camera add safety and monitoring over the X1C's chamber camera.

Prusa Research Mini+

Proven reliability over 5+ years

The Mini+ has been on the market since 2021 and has proven its durability with thousands of community print-hours logged.

Fully open source and repairable

Prusa stocks replacement parts for all Mini+ components. Community guides cover every repair scenario.

Affordable Prusa entry point

The lowest-cost way to enter the Prusa ecosystem with a fully supported printer.
